package jose
import (
"encoding/json"
"fmt"
"math/big"
"testing"
)
func TestRsaJwk(t *testing.T) {
fmt.Println("--> TestRsaJwk")
in := `{
"kty": "RSA",
"n": "n4EPtAOCc9AlkeQHPzHStgAbgs7bTZLwUBZdR8_KuKPEHLd4rHVTeT-O-XV2jRojdNhxJWTDvNd7nqQ0VEiZQHz_AJmSCpMaJMRBSFKrKb2wqVwGU_NsYOYL-QtiWN2lbzcEe6XC0dApr5ydQLrHqkHHig3RBordaZ6Aj-oBHqFEHYpPe7Tpe-OfVfHd1E6cS6M1FZcD1NNLYD5lFHpPI9bTwJlsde3uhGqC0ZCuEHg8lhzwOHrtIQbS0FVbb9k3-tVTU4fg_3L_vniUFAKwuCLqKnS2BYwdq_mzSnbLY7h_qixoR7jig3__kRhuaxwUkRz5iaiQkqgc5gHdrNP5zw",
"e": "AQAB"
}`
var out JsonWebKey
err := json.Unmarshal([]byte(in), &out)
if err != nil {
t.Errorf("JSON unmarshal error: %+v", err)
return
}
if out.KeyType != "RSA" {
t.Errorf("Incorrect key type %+v, expecting %+v", out.KeyType, "RSA")
return
}
if out.Rsa == nil {
t.Errorf("RSA key not present")
return
}
if out.Rsa.E != 0x010001 {
t.Errorf("Incorrect public exponent %+v, expecting %+v", out.Rsa.E, 0x010001)
return
}

func TestEcJwk(t *testing.T) {
fmt.Println("--> TestEcJwk")
in := `{
"kty": "EC",
"crv": "P-521",
"x": "AHKZLLOsCOzz5cY97ewNUajB957y-C-U88c3v13nmGZx6sYl_oJXu9A5RkTKqjqvjyekWF-7ytDyRXYgCF5cj0Kt",
"y": "AdymlHvOiLxXkEhayXQnNCvDX4h9htZaCJN34kfmC6pV5OhQHiraVySsUdaQkAgDPrwQrJmbnX9cwlGfP-HqHZR1"
}`
var out JsonWebKey
err := json.Unmarshal([]byte(in), &out)
if err != nil {
t.Errorf("JSON unmarshal error: %+v", err)
return
}
if out.KeyType != "EC" {
t.Errorf("Incorrect key type %+v, expecting %+v", out.KeyType, "RSA")
return
}
if out.Ec == nil {
t.Errorf("EC key not present")
return
}
if out.Ec.Curve.Params().BitSize != 521 {
t.Errorf("Incorrect curve size %+v, expecting %+v", out.Ec.Curve.Params().BitSize, 521)
return
}
